Output e63b9b30f1c1984b009cde3c8bea8ac803818aad0618a6bc31d0329f7f0f416a:20

value
115795795
script pubkey
OP_0 OP_PUSHBYTES_32 addd384251766632f9eabb5e4e3d66f5b99922b77ea6ae0c4c3d75b056f5fef1
address
bc1q4hwnssj3wenr9702hd0yu0tx7kuejg4h06n2urzv846mq4h4lmcskdwqlz
transaction
e63b9b30f1c1984b009cde3c8bea8ac803818aad0618a6bc31d0329f7f0f416a
spent
true